Querybook开源大数据查询分析工具深度评测
随着大数据技术的快速发展,企业对于数据查询和分析工具的需求日益增加。Querybook作为一款新兴的开源大数据查询分析工具,因其灵活性和开源特性备受关注。本文将从多个维度对Querybook进行全面剖析,结合真实使用体验,探讨其优势与不足,并对适用人群做出精准建议,助力读者判断是否适合自家业务场景。
一、Querybook简介
Querybook是一款基于开源理念打造的智能大数据查询与分析平台,支持多种数据源接入,涵盖Hive、Presto、ClickHouse等主流查询引擎。它为数据分析师、开发者和数据工程师提供了一站式的查询、协作和管理环境。工具功能不断迭代,致力于简化大数据查询复杂度,提升工作效率。
二、如何使用Querybook进行搜索查询?
Querybook的查询体验设计简单直观,允许用户借助“查询编辑器”输入SQL语句,系统能够即时解析并返回查询结果。以下是详细操作步骤:
- 连接数据源:登陆后,首先需要配置或选择已有的数据源,支持多引擎切换,方便不同场景下的多样化查询。
- 编写SQL语句:在编辑器中输入标准SQL,支持语法高亮和自动补全,极大降低语法错误率,提升编辑速度。
- 执行查询:点击“运行”按钮,后台会将SQL传递到对应引擎,实时返回查询结果,且支持分页显示和结果导出。
- 搜索历史和标签:可通过历史记录快速复用过往查询,支持为SQL添加标签,方便归档和团队协作。
除此之外,Querybook还支持复杂查询组合和参数化查询,满足实际业务多样需求。在查询时,用户还能结合结果视图轻松生成可视化报表,从而对数据趋势和异常进行深入洞察。
三、真实体验评测
基于我们团队在实际项目中的多轮使用体验,以下是对Querybook在功能表现、操作体验、性能表现等方面的深入观察:
1. 功能丰富且实用
Querybook不仅支持多数据源接入,还带有版本管理功能,使得SQL的修改和合并变得高效安全。其权限管理模块细致,能针对不同角色定制访问权限,满足企业级安全要求。多用户协作功能令人印象深刻,团队成员可以通过注释和标签轻松沟通,提高了整体协调效率。
2. 界面简洁,操作流畅
整体界面布局合理,查询编辑器响应速度快,语法高亮和自动补全功能非常到位,令写SQL的过程更加顺畅。配色柔和且易辨识,长时间使用亦不易疲劳。搜索和过滤历史记录的功能设计得非常人性化,帮助用户快速精准地定位目标查询。
3. 性能表现稳定
在连接Hive和Presto集群时,执行大规模复杂查询稳定性表现突出,系统对并发查询的支持也较为良好。通过本地缓存机制,部分重复查询的响应时间得以显著缩短,提升了整体的数据交互体验。
4. 细节尚有改进空间
虽然Querybook整体表现优异,但在部分极端场景下仍存在一定不足。比如,加载超大规模的查询结果时,前端页面偶尔会出现短暂卡顿;另外,某些数据源的兼容性细节需要进一步优化。文档对新手入门的指引稍显简略,希望未来能增强教程内容和示例项目。
四、Querybook的优点总结
- 开源免费:具备极高的性价比,用户社群活跃,生态资源丰富。
- 支持多数据引擎:灵活多样,适配各种大数据存储方案。
- 操作体验优秀:简洁的UI设计,强大的查询编辑器功能,减少学习成本。
- 团队协作能力强:标签、版本控制、权限管理全面覆盖企业需求。
- 运行稳定:处理并发查询和大数据量时表现可靠。
五、存在的不足
- 前端性能瓶颈:在超大数据集展示时响应略显迟缓。
- 文档完善度略逊:缺少系统化的入门教程和操作视频,新用户上手门槛稍高。
- 兼容性问题:部分边缘数据源支持不够理想,需要更多扩展。
- 高级功能缺失:目前还未提供复杂的图形化报表设计器,更多为基础查询和简单可视化。
六、适用人群分析
Querybook凭借其强大的功能和开源属性,特别适合以下几类用户:
- 企业数据分析团队:需要统一查询平台协作,快速迭代数据模型和报表的组织。
- 数据工程师和开发者:常规运行多数据源查询任务,希望简化工作流,提高效率。
- 初创公司及中小企业:预算有限,倾向选用免费且功能全面的数据查询工具。
- 开源技术爱好者及社区贡献者:希望参与社区共建,以需求驱动产品演进。
然而,若企业需要极致的图形化数据可视化、BI集成或不容忍任何性能延迟的场景下,可能需要配合其他专业工具共同使用。
七、最终结论
综合评估来看,Querybook是一款值得推荐的开源大数据查询分析利器。它平衡了功能丰富性与使用便捷性,解决了多种数据源融合和协同查询难题,在成本和扩展性方面具有明显优势。虽然存在细节不足,但对于绝大多数需要高效数据查询与协作的团队而言,Querybook完全具备成为核心平台的潜力。
未来伴随社区持续投入和版本迭代,相信Querybook在性能优化、可视化表现、用户体验上会有更大提升。如果您正在寻找一款灵活、开源、易用且适应多种数据引擎的查询工具,Querybook无疑值得一试。
—— 本文为Querybook 2024最新版使用后的深度体验总结